How ozempic affects your sexual movement

Ozempic and other semiaglutide -based weight loss medicines like Wegovy and Rybelsus were Create headlines For its proven efficiency by helping people lose weight. Such medicines can be a player who changes for those who have struggled with weight loss all their lives and help many people control chronic, life -threatening diseases such as diabetes.

Of course, all medicines – especially effective – inevitably come with side effects. Well documented Ozempic side effects Include the reactions of the position, the fatigue and a series of gastrointestinal issues that deserve their own position.

Whether with a correlation or causal relevance, a particularly interesting side effect of these weight loss drugs seems to be the way it can affect libido. Below we dip the way drugs such as Ozempic Work, how can it affect your sexual movement and some ways to cope with ozempic fluctuations in libido.

How does it affect the libido ozempic

If you are wondering if Ozempic can affect your sexual movement, the short answer is: probably.

The body runs in a series of incredibly complex, interrelated systems and any disorders in homeostasis will cause reactions to many parts of the body. If you lose a heavy weight in a relatively short period of time, your libido It will probably be affected independently of the drug you take.

While there are anecdotal reports about how the ozempic effects of sexual movement, reports are often contradictory and more studies are needed to explain exactly how the drug affects libido. It is important to take into account factors such as age, hormonal balance, overall health, OZEMPIC Drug interactions (if you are in other medicines) and psychological well -being if you notice a change in your libido when on medicine.

If ozempic reduces your sexual movement

A recent study showed that non -diabetic men using semiaglitis to lose weight may have higher cases of erectile dysfunction. Researchers argue that it may be due to the way the drug lean the intestinetogether with how weight loss decreases testosterone. Lower testosterone levels can also Reduce sex to womenAnd the hormonal changes caused by the changes that your body undergo can also contribute to reduced libido.

A less sexy explanation lies in the unpleasant problems in the stomach, including nausea, diarrhea and constipation, which some OZEMPIC users may experience. When dealing with frequent bowel issues commonly referred to in the use of semiaglitis, your sexual movement will of course become less priority.

If you find yourself Hornier after the start of Ozempic

Most studies conducted in OZEMPIC show no increase in sexual movement, but some people report one increase in their libido after the drug start. This may be due to how weight loss in some people allows them to access a wider range of motion and move more.

Because you are moving more, You may have more energy and your natural endorphin levels may be higher. In addition, the push of trust that comes with the most comfortable in your body can also help you feel sexier and increase your desire for sexual activity.

How to deal with sexual side effects

If you face significant personality or changes in OZEMPIC libido, you should always consult your doctor. Below are some steps you can take to manage the sexual side effects that your doctor may also recommend:

Contact your medical provider

Discussing any concerns about your sexual health with your healthcare provider is an important part of your OZEMPIC trip. Your doctor may provide guidance, adjust the dosage or investigate alternative treatment options.

Modification of your diet

Ozempic only helps you eat less. It does not replenish the necessary nutrients or helps you adjust your existing diet. Getting all your necessary nutrients with lower calorie intake is essential for healthy sexual function and overall well -being.

Consult your medical provider or an authorized nutritionist to calculate a diet plan that suits your new lifestyle needs and meets all your dietary requirements so that your body – and sexual movement – works optimally.

Exercise regularly

Exercise enhances testosterone, may help Adjust the hormonal fluctuationsAnd it gives you more energy – all that can improve your sex life.

Seek support

Participation in a diabetes management support team or online community that focuses on healthy weight loss habits can help you access potentially important knowledge from other people passing through the same matches.
